Key Responsibilities:
- Manual Software Verification
: - Perform manual testing of embedded software to ensure functionality, performance, and compliance with design specifications.
- Test Protocol Development
: - Design, review, and update test protocols to ensure comprehensive verification of software and hardware systems.
- Compliance and Risk Management
: - Ensure compliance with medical device standards, including ISO 13485 (Quality Management),
ISO 14971 (Risk Management), and IEC 62304 (Software Development Lifecycle). - Test Equipment Operation
: - Utilize and maintain test equipment such as oscilloscopes
, function generators
, DMMs (Digital Multimeters), and PSUs (Power Supply Units). - Communication Protocol Testing
: - Test and validate communication protocols like RS-232 and RS-485 to ensure seamless integration and functionality.
- Conduct DVT to verify that the product meets all design requirements and specifications.
- Defect Identification and Analysis
: - Identify, document, and analyze defects, perform root cause analysis, and collaborate with development teams to implement solutions.
- Documentation and Reporting
: - Maintain detailed documentation of test results, protocols, and compliance reports.
- Collaboration and Communication
: - Work closely with cross-functional teams, including software developers, hardware engineers, and quality assurance professionals.
- Communicate effectively with stakeholders at all levels of the organization.
